WebCiting sources with notes To cite sources in Chicago notes and bibliography style, place a superscript number at the end of a sentence or clause, after the punctuation mark, corresponding to a numbered footnote or endnote. Footnotes appear at the bottom of each page, while endnotes appear at the end of the text. Decide on the Bible passage to reference. To footnote the Bible using Turabian style, include the abbreviated name of the book and the chapter and verse number, separated with a colon. With Turabian style, you can spell out the name of the version or abbreviate it. Cite the version the first time used, or when you switch versions.
